The pressure dependent fracture permeability of four granitic rock samples was determined in a triaxial test cell under hydrostatic loading conditions at a temperature of 30°C. Tensile fractures were generated in cylindrical samples by Brazilian tests. Confining pressures were cycled twice between 2 and 50MPa. Uniaxial and triaxial compression tests as well as splitting tests were conducted on granite specimens after acidic solution erosion at a variety of different pH values and flow rates. The responses of strength loss, deformation behavior and mechanical parameters of the granite were compared and analyzed.
